I believe there is a continuum between Just and Unjust war. For instance, the USA used the fictitious excuse of Weapons of Mass Destruction to invade Iraq in an attempt to take control of their oil fields. That was an obviously unjust action and we were right to stay out of it. Ukraine has been invaded by Russia, also in an unjust action, and it is correct for us to support Ukrainian resistance to Russian aggression. While we want to live in peace with our neighbours, we now have to prepare plans to defend ourselves from unjust aggression from the Trump’s criminal regime.
